The Minnesota Vikings can’t seem to catch a break this off-season. Their offensive coordinator kicked this off with a drunk driving incident a few months ago. Wide receiver Jordan Addison added a DWI of his own this past week, mere days after his rookie teammate, Khyrie Jackson, was killed during another. They didn’t get the quarterback they wanted, Drake Maye, in the draft and had to settle for J.J. McCarthy. Now McCarthy is approaching a holdout because they refuse to fully guarantee his signing bonus.
